Glazed Chocolate Donuts

These glazed chocolate donuts are soft and moist and dipped in a sweet glaze!
Course Dessert
Cuisine American
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 8 minutes
Total Time 18 minutes
Servings 10 donuts
Calories 258kcal

Ingredients

For the donuts

  • 1 cup flour
  • 1/2 cup sugar
  • 1/4 cup natural cocoa powder
  • 1/4 cup mini chocolate chips optional
  • 1/2 teaspoon baking soda
  • 1/4 teaspoon salt
  • 1/2 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 1 large egg
  • 6 tablespoons sour cream
  • 1/4 cup milk
  • 1/4 cup vegetable oil

For the glaze

  • 1 1/2 cups powdered sugar
  • 1/4 cup milk
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la

Instructions

To make the donuts

  • Preheat oven to 375 degrees.
  • In a medium mixing bowl, combine the flour, sugar, cocoa powder, chocolate chips, baking soda, and salt.
  • In a small bowl, beat together the vanilla, egg, sour cream, milk, and oil.
  • Stir the wet ingredients into the dry until just combined.
  • Spoon in a greased donut pan.
  • Bake for 8 minutes or until the tops spring back when you touch them.
  • Let the donuts cool in the pan before glazing.

To make the glaze

  • Whisk together the powdered sugar, milk, and vanilla until smooth.
  • Dunk the donuts in the glaze to fully coat and place on a wire rack to set, about 5 minutes.

Notes

You'll want to use natural cocoa powder here so that the donuts rise properly.
